Stephen Letko

Stephen Letko

Stephen Letko launched his own firm, SPL Enterprises LLC, in 2000 after a distinguished career in executive positions with companies including Dodson Steel Products, Mills Iron Works and Crane Company. His expertise includes implementation of new markets, restructuring companies to improve their financial position, and developing marketing, quality and employee incentive programs.
